Advanced Clinical Informatics Pharmacist
The Trust implemented Oracle Health’s Millennium ePR in June 2023, and as well as optimising this system, numerous digital medicines management and transfer of care developments are in the pipeline which has led to the need to expand the current pharmacist complement in the Clinical Informatics team.
Main duties of the job
The post holder will work lead the optimisation, and governance of electronic prescribing and medicines administration (ePMA) systems, ensuring safe, effective, and efficient use of medicines across the Trust. The role has significant impact on patient safety, clinical governance, and operational efficiency across the organisation, influencing prescribing practices and digital workflows at Trust and ICS level.
About us
The ePMA function sits under Clinical Informatics, in the Data and Digital Division, whilst maintaining close professional links with the Pharmacy Directorate.The post features an average of four days each week in Clinical Informatics with a blend of on site and home working, and the remainder in front line Pharmacy working.
Job responsibilities
Provide professional supervision and daytoday guidance to Clinical Informatics staff.
Provide specialist input into design, configuration, and implementation under senior guidance of the ePMA and other related clinical systems.
Develop and implement IT solutions to improve medicines management, including configuration, testing, upgrades, and system administration.
Collaborate with informatics, clinical, and operational colleagues to drive change, optimise system use, and support business process redesign.
